Muffin45's Badges » NewestAll Badges
Sort:
Badge earned
Merchant Menace Badge
(completed)
Muffin45 earned this badge in Sheep Happens Mobile on May. 28, 2016.
Badge earned
Ewe'll Be Sorry Badge
(completed)
Muffin45 earned this badge in Sheep Happens Mobile on May. 28, 2016.
|